Teachers in Ogbomoso, Oyo State have taken to the streets in a wave of protest over the abduction of schoolchildren and teachers in parts of the state, escalating public pressure on authorities to respond decisively to worsening insecurity in schools. The protesting teachers expressed anger, fear and frustration over repeated attacks on educational institutions, insisting that classrooms have become unsafe for both pupils and staff.
